Uber fresh fish - to die for!
When I moved to the island a month ago, I fantasized about fresh fish sustainably caught by local fishermen. I had been checking out the Local I'a website about a month before arriving, since I'm a big fan of CSA - their CSF model seemed like a good fit.
Yes, you're going to pay a bit more than you will from Times or Costco, but if your budget allows, I would highly recommend splurging on their quality fish. You can even trace your catch back to where, when, and who caught it!
So far, I've tried the Ono (sashimi and baked) and Aku (sashimi and seared). I'm in fish heav-en! Each Sunday, I pick up my share (1.5-2 lb) from the Mililani Farmers Market. I get there early, so I get to choose exactly which fish I want based on that week's selection from the ice chest. The fish look SO fresh and vibrant - hard to choose.
If it's a large fish, it's already filleted. Not sure about the smaller fish, though I think you can get them whole.
They gave me a small cooler for my fish on that first week and fill it with ice to keep the fish cold on the drive home.
I asked for recipes, as I had NO idea what to do with Ono the first time. I'm a Midwest girl from the mainland, so knowing what to do with fish does not come naturally. She gave some tips, and I felt much more confident prepping the fish!
I plan to be a CSF member for the near future and look forward to expanding my palate in the process.
